In the early nineties I met Saskia Bosman. She was a materials chemist at the University of the Hague when she experienced an encounter with an 'Archangel'. She was instructed to set up quite complex brass and crystal structures at some dozen locations around the world and to ensure that they remained there in place until 2018.

Though she resisted at first, in the end she journeyed to every location and found homes for these structures, called Earthgates.
